Meet the cast of ‘Off Campus’—Prime Video’s record-breaking new adult romance drama

Prime Video’s steamy and soapy Off Campus, the adaptation of Canadian author Elle Kennedy’s series of hockey-themed new adult romance novels, is a certified hit. It already holds the title for the third most-watched debut on the streamer. The series centres around the loves, lives and friendships of the students at the fictional Boston college, Briar University (Briar U, in the series parlance).

Season one is based on The Deal, the first book in the series, and follows the love story between music major Hannah Wells (Ella Bright) and star hockey player Garrett Graham (Belmont Cameli). In classic fake relationship trope, the two make a deal—he’ll help her get her crush’s attention by pretending to date her in exchange for helping him pass their philosophy class—and end up getting more than what they bargained for.

While the first season focuses on the main couple, it introduces audiences to the cast of characters that populate Briar University and the wider world of Elle Kennedy's bestselling series. It also sets up the rest of the books, teasing upcoming love stories in future seasons of Off Campus.

Ella Bright as Hannah Wells

During Ella Bright’s guest appearance on The Kelly Clarkson Show, many were surprised to learn—Kelly Clarkson included—that the lead actress of Prime Video’s hit series Off Campus speaks in a British accent in real life. As it turned out, she was born in America but grew up in London. At age 12, she starred in the BBC boarding school series Malory Towers. Later, she portrayed a 15-year-old Kate Middleton—in a blink-and-you’ll-miss-it moment—in season six, episode seven of Netflix’s The Crown.

Off Campus marked her first leading role as the charming and earnest Hannah Wells, an aspiring singer-songwriter who fell for Briar U’s hockey star, Garrett Graham (Belmont Cameli). Bright brought refreshing relatability and warmth to the part, making it easy for audiences to fall for Hannah (or Wellsy, as Garrett called her) and root for her. She also handled Hannah’s past trauma with care and sensitivity. Her chemistry—not just with her leading man but with her onscreen bestie, Mika Abdalla—stood out as one of the series’ highlights.

Bright also revealed in interviews that, despite not considering herself a singer, she performed all the vocals in Off Campus, training with a vocal coach to prepare for the role.

Belmont Cameli as Garrett Graham

As Off Campus’ sensitive and brooding Garrett Graham—Briar Hawks’s strapping hockey captain—Belmont Cameli is Prime Video’s newest heartthrob. Cameli is no stranger to romance novel adaptations, having starred as the leading man in Netflix’s 2022 film version of Sarah Dessen’s BookTok favourite Along for the Ride.

He was part of the cast of The Alto Knights along with Off Campus co-star Antonio Cipriano and had a role in the 2020 reboot of Saved by the Bell. But Garrett Graham is undoubtedly his breakout role. His Garrett is strong and soft, sexy and sweet. He’s the type of fictional boyfriend women wish existed in real life. The sparks he shares with co-star Ella Bright—immediately evident from their first chemistry read—make their connection feel genuine.

But beyond the romance, Cameli gives his character weight, especially in scenes showing Garrett struggling to break free from the shadow of his father’s NHL legacy and history of domestic abuse. In Off Campus, audiences have found a new leading man worth watching for. 

Mika Abdalla as Allie Hayes

Off Campus couldn’t have found a better Allie Hayes—Hannah’s sexy, supportive best friend—than Mika Abdalla. Her Allie is vivacious and sympathetic, grounding her friendship with Hannah in reality. Meanwhile, it’s through Allie’s complicated situationship with Briar University’s resident party boy, Dean Di Laurentis (Stephen Kalyn), that viewers get to know the character more—revealing a mixture of confidence and vulnerability that makes her relatable.

Abdalla has been honing her craft since her early days on Netflix’s Project Mc2. She also had a five-episode story arc in season eight of The CW’s popular superhero series The Flash, playing Phantom Girl, and appeared as a patient in a multiple-episode arc in season one of HBO Max’s hit medical drama The Pitt.

Up next for the actress is season two of Off Campus. Based on The Score, the third book in the series, the second season is set to see Allie and Dean take the spotlight. Audiences can expect more of Abdalla and Kalyn’s electric chemistry, as well as the next chapter of their love story.

Stephen Kalyn as Dean Di Laurentis

Built like a Greek god, with an insatiable appetite for hedonism, Dean Di Laurentis, played by Stephen Kalyn, would be easy to dismiss as another college playboy. But it takes only a few episodes to see that Dean has hidden depths: he’s big on consent, is the number one Hannah and Garrett shipper, gives surprisingly insightful relationship advice and actually fell first and fell harder for Allie Hayes.

Like most of his castmates, Off Campus is Kalyn’s big break. He’s built up a presence on Prime Video, though, playing a recurring role in Gen V—the spinoff to the critically acclaimed series The Boys—and making a guest appearance in the Cruel Intentions reboot.

Season two is set to bring the love story of Allie and Dean to the fore. However, fans of the couple’s slow-burn romance and sizzling chemistry will need to wait till next year to learn what happens after season one’s explosive cliffhanger.

Antonio Cipriano as John Logan

John Logan is Briar Hawks’s popular right wing, Garrett Graham’s loyal best friend and (series-exclusive character) Jules’s beloved older brother. Although he's warm and friendly, he walks around with a huge chip on his shoulder, weighed down by a difficult family history and fears of an uncertain future.

He’s played by Antonio Cipriano, who debuted in the Broadway musical Jagged Little Pill in 2019. He was also in National Treasure: Edge of History, the Disney+ spinoff of the Nicolas Cage film franchise, and HBO Max’s Pretty Little Liars: Original Sin, the continuation of Pretty Little Liars.

In season one of Off Campus, audiences learn that John’s a yearner, thanks to his unrequited crush on Hannah, and fiercely loyal to Garrett—sacrificing his feelings and ultimately supporting their relationship. Meanwhile, John’s own love story is expected to take centre stage in season three. Based on The Mistake, the second novel in Elle Kennedy’s bestselling book series, the third season should follow his second-chance romance with Grace Ivers (played by India Fowler), who, by all indications, will be soft-launched in season two.

Jalen Thomas Brooks as John Tucker

Rounding out the core hockey squad in Off Campus is Briar Hawks’s forward John Tucker (Jalen Thomas Brooks). As the youngest, John is often on the receiving end of some good-natured teasing from Garrett, Dean and John Logan. A bit about his background is revealed in the first season, including his love for cooking, Type-A tendencies and close relationship with his single mom.

Brooks is best known for his recurring role as Nurse Mateo Diaz in HBO Max’s critically acclaimed medical series The Pitt (where he even shared a scene with Off Campus co-star Mika Abdalla). He also starred in The CW’s Walker and the Eli Roth horror movie Thanksgiving.

While Tucker is introduced in the first season of Off Campus, most of his scenes revolve around his friendships with his teammates. However, readers of Elle Kennedy’s novels know that Tucker eventually gets his own love story in The Goal, the fourth book in the series. Featuring an accidental pregnancy storyline and a more mature side of the easy-going hockey player, it is one of the arcs fans are most eager to see if Prime Video continues adapting the bestselling books.

With season two already confirmed and more books in Elle Kennedy's bestselling Off Campus series waiting to be adapted, audiences can expect to spend plenty more time at Briar University. From Hannah and Garrett's swoon-worthy romance to the future love stories of Dean, Allie, Logan and Tucker, the cast of Off Campus is only just getting started.
